Safety and Efficacy of Tirofiban During Intravenous Thrombolysis Bridging to Mechanical Thrombectomy for Acute Ischemic Stroke Patients: A Meta-Analysis
ConclusionThe use of tirofiban during IVT bridging mechanical thrombectomy for AIS does not increase the risk of sICH and ICH in patients and reduces the risk of postoperative re-occlusion and mortality in patients within 3 months. However, this result needs to be further confirmed by additional large-sample, multicenter, prospective randomized controlled trials.Systematic Review Registrationhttp://www.crd.york.ac.uk/PROSPERO/, identifier: CRD42022297441.

Current Challenges and Future Directions in Handling Stroke Patients With Patent Foramen Ovale —A Brief Review
The role of patent foramen ovale (PFO) in stroke was debated for decades. Randomized clinical trials (RCTs) have shown fewer recurrent events after PFO closure in patients with cryptogenic stroke (CS). However, in clinical practice, treating stroke patients with coexisting PFO raises some questions. This brief review summarizes current knowledge and challenges in handling stroke patients with PFO and identifies issues for future research. Ischemic Stroke of Suspected Cardioembolic Origin Despite Anticoagulation: Does Thrombus Analysis Help to Clarify Etiology?
ConclusionThrombi of the suspected cardioembolic origin of patients with prior OAC do not differ in their histologic composition from those without prior OAC, but both differ from non-cardioembolic thrombi. These histologic results make a non-cardioembolic etiology for strokes despite prior OAC rather unlikely but favor other reasons for these ischemic events. Perviousness assessment reinforces the histologic findings, with additional information about the OAC thrombi, which present with higher perviousness. J147 Reduces tPA-Induced Brain Hemorrhage in Acute Experimental Stroke in Rats
ConclusionOur results demonstrate that J147 treatment alone exerts cerebral cytoprotective effects in a suture model of acute ischemic stroke, while in an embolic stroke model co-administration of J147 with tPA reduces delayed tPA-induced intracerebral hemorrhage and confers cerebroprotection. These findings suggest that J147-tPA combination therapy could be a promising approach to improving the treatment of ischemic stroke.
